Hardscape wall construction services involve building durable, functional walls using materials like concrete, stone, brick, or block. These walls are designed to enhance outdoor spaces by providing structure, privacy, and aesthetic appeal. They are often used to create retaining walls that hold back soil on sloped properties, as well as boundary walls that define property lines. Skilled contractors ensure that these walls are properly engineered to withstand environmental pressures, resulting in long-lasting solutions that improve the overall look and usability of a property.
This service helps address common problems such as soil erosion, uneven terrain, and lack of privacy. For properties with sloping yards or uneven ground, retaining walls can prevent soil from collapsing or washing away during heavy rains. Additionally, wall construction can help delineate outdoor living areas, creating a sense of separation and privacy from neighbors or busy streets. Properly built walls can also serve as a foundation for additional features like patios, gardens, or outdoor kitchens, making outdoor spaces more functional and enjoyable.

The overview below groups typical Hardscape Wall Construction proj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Small Wall Repairs - minor repairs such as fixing cracks or replacing a few blocks typically cost between $250 and $600. Many routine repair projects fall within this range, depending on the extent of damage and materials used.
Standard Block Walls - building a new standard-height wall with common materials usually ranges from $2,000 to $5,000. Most projects in this category are straightforward installations completed within this cost band.
Custom or Decorative Walls - more elaborate designs with unique finishes or complex patterns can range from $5,000 to $15,000. Larger or highly customized projects tend to push into the higher end of this spectrum.
Full Wall Replacement - replacing an existing wall entirely, especially in larger or multi-section projects, can cost $10,000 or more. Such projects are less common and often involve significant excavation and structural work.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of walls can local contractors build with hardscape materials? Local service providers can construct a variety of walls, including retaining walls, decorative garden walls, and boundary walls, using materials like stone, brick, or concrete blocks.
Are hardscape walls suitable for sloped terrains? Yes, many local contractors have experience building retaining walls that help manage slopes and prevent erosion, enhancing both stability and appearance.
What materials are commonly used for hardscape wall construction? Common materials include natural stone, concrete blocks, brick, and manufactured stone, chosen based on the project’s aesthetic and functional requirements.
Can hardscape walls be integrated into landscape designs? Absolutely, local pros can incorporate hardscape walls into landscape plans to create terraces, seating areas, or decorative features that complement the overall design.
What factors influence the durability of a hardscape wall? Factors such as material quality, proper foundation preparation, and construction techniques used by local contractors contribute to the wall’s longevity and stability.
